Surat Thani: Immigration round up illegal foreigners throughout the province

Naew Na reported that a variety of illegal immigrants and over stayers had been rounded up in operations by immigration police throughout the province of Surat Thani in Thailand's south. 

 

Those arrested ranged from migrants to an apparent Western tourist to a som tam (papaya salad) seller.

Arrests took place on Koh Samui, Koh Phangan and the mainland. 

 

On Samui a man called Alexander - no nationality was given - was picked up off the street in Maret on a 100 day overstay and handed over to the Bo Phut police. 

 

On Phangan a 47 year old Nepali man was arrested on Had Rin beach for a 759 day overstay.

On the mainland in a fresh food market in Phun Phin a Laotian woman was arrested at a som tam stall. 

 

At a rubber plantation Kanthu, 22, a migrant from Myanmar was arrested for illegal entry into the kingdom.

Surat Thani immigration, several divisions of the tourist police and Krabi immigration were all named by Naew Na as being involved in the latest arrests. 

 

They asked the public to keep the calls coming to the immigration's hotline to report illegal activity.
